Delhi Police forms online citizen communities

In a first, Delhi Police has set up online citizen communities for all the 11 districts to improve its interface for communicating effectively with the residents.
The initiative aims at improving law and order in the state by connecting the citizens with each other and their district police.
Over 35,000 people have already become members of the 11 district level law and order circles. Using these online communities, district police can abreast them on crime related information, tips, local police initiatives among others, said a senior police official.
The official said that residents will also be able to bring up law and order issues in their respective district communities and seek assistance from other members or the police.
In less than a week since the constitution of communities, people are reporting and discussing issues like chain snatching, crime against women, unauthorized parking, street vendor encroachments, police said.
